
When Donald Trump offered a vague and questionable tax plan to the media, economic experts reported that the wealthy would benefit greatly, the working class would experience little or no change, and the nation’s deficit would be increased by trillions of dollars. Today, Speaker of the House, Paul Ryan offered his plan, which is eerily similar to the man he once opposed and now endorses.
MSNBC reported that the contents of Ryan’s plan “includes trillions of dollars in tax breaks for the wealthy, including the total elimination of the estate tax, but it doesn’t include any meaningful accounting. House Republicans spent months putting together a ‘substantive’ tax-reform plan that’s little more than a wish list of all the taxes the GOP would like to cut, without so much as a hint of thought about how to pay for the package.”
